Mirlovača
Mirlovača is a spring in Šibenik-Knin County, Croatia and has an elevation of 854 metres. Mirlovača is situated nearby to the locality Repište, as well as near the village Plavno.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Strmica is a small village in the Knin Municipality. It is located north of Knin, just south of the border to Bosnia and Herzegovina. The population is 160. Strmica is situated 4½ km east of Mirlovača.
